Character.ai Shifts Focus to Consumer Products Post $2.7bn Google Deal
- Character.ai is pivoting from building AI models to enhancing its consumer products following Google's $2.7bn deal. - The company's new interim CEO, Dominic Perella, revealed that the focus will now be on their popular chatbots. - This decision comes after Google hired 20% of Character.ai's staff, including co-founders Noam Shazeer and Daniel De Freitas. - With the funds from the Google deal, Character.ai bought out its investors and distributed company ownership among employees. - The company plans to continue AI research and is hopeful of avoiding antitrust concerns. Microsoft Taps DeepMind Talent for New AI Health Unit
- Mustafa Suleyman, co-founder of DeepMind, is leading Microsoft's new AI health team, hiring ex-DeepMind staff to build consumer health applications. - Key hires include Dominic King and Christopher Kelly, enhancing Microsoft's team with their expertise in AI and healthcare. - As tech companies race to monetize generative AI, Microsoft's initiative focuses on integrating AI into everyday health queries and applications.
